Penn State Football Sticks At No. 8 In AP Poll

Penn State football was ranked No. 8 in the latest AP Poll, the Associated Press announced Sunday.

Despite barely avoiding an upset against Bowling Green on Saturday, the Nittany Lions were bailed out by losses from then-No. 5 Notre Dame and No. 10 Michigan.

Michigan fell out of the top 10 with its 34-12 loss to Texas while Ohio State remained the top-ranked team in the Big Ten at No. 3, sliding from the No. 2 spot taken by the Longhorns. Despite two close games, Oregon remained in the top 10 at No. 9.

Georgia, Alabama, Ole Miss, Missouri, and Tennessee round out the teams ranked ahead of Penn State.

Penn State has a bye this week but will return to Beaver Stadium to face Kent State on September 21. The kickoff time and television coverage have yet to be determined.
